Koylari - Chandia, Umaria
Koylari is a village situated in the Chandia tehsil of Umaria district, Madhya Pradesh. It is located approximately 12 km from the tehsil headquarters in Chandia and around 32 km from the district headquarters in Umaria. Kaoylari serves as the Gram Panchayat for Koylari village.
As per Census 2011, the village code of Koylari is 467708. The village covers a total geographical area of 521.8 hectares and falls under the 484660 pincode. Chandia is the nearest town, located about 12 km away.
Koylari village is governed under the Panchayati Raj system, with a Sarpanch serving as the elected head.
Population of Koylari
As per Census 2011, Koylari village has a total population of 1,222 people, consisting of 641 males and 581 females. The village has 268 households and a sex ratio of 906 females per 1,000 males. There are 214 children in the 0–6 years age group. The village has 711 literate and 511 illiterate residents. Additionally, 52 people belong to Scheduled Caste (SC) communities and 545 to Scheduled Tribe (ST) communities.
Detailed gender-wise population figures for Koylari are given below:
| Category | Total | Male | Female |
|---|---|---|---|
| Total Population | 1,222 | 641 | 581 |
| Child Population (0–6 yrs) | 214 | 121 | 93 |
| Scheduled Castes (SC) | 52 | 24 | 28 |
| Scheduled Tribes (ST) | 545 | 292 | 253 |
| Literate Population | 711 | 436 | 275 |
| Illiterate Population | 511 | 205 | 306 |

Transport and Connectivity of Koylari
Koylari is connected by an all-weather road, and public transport is mainly available through shared auto-rickshaws. The nearest railway station is located within >10 km of Koylari.
| Connectivity | Status | Nearest Availability |
|---|---|---|
| Public Bus Service | No | Available within >10 km |
| Private Bus Service | No | Available within >10 km |
| Railway Station | No | Available within >10 km |
In addition to basic transport facilities, distances and travel times help define overall connectivity. The road distance from Chandia to Koylari is about 12 km, with a usual travel time of around 30-60 minutes. Similarly, the road distance from Umaria to Koylari is about 32 km, with the usual travel time around 1-1.25 hours. Actual travel time may vary depending on road conditions and mode of transport.
